WebJan 15, 2024 · 10. 1-Variation in erythrocyte size (anisocytosis) 1-Microcytosis: Morphology: - Decrease in the red cell size. Red cells are smaller than ± 7µm in diameter. The nucleus of a small lymphocyte (± 8,µm) is a useful guide to the size of a red blood cell. Found in: - Iron deficiency anemia. WebJun 29, 2015 · The typical reason for this abnormality is some sort of hemoglobinopathy, or at least a failure to clear the normal (usually small) proportion of abnormal red blood cells. You will see lots of target cells in. Thalassemia. Hepatic disease with jaundice.
